The 20th century experienced unprecedented urbanization and infrastructure growth, placing immense pressure on drainage services worldwide. Rising cities required robust drainage networks to allow for expanding populations, sprawling urban areas, and increased industrialization. Governments and municipal authorities spent greatly in drainage infrastructure, implementing comprehensive preparing, style, and preservation strategies to guarantee the resilience and stability of those systems. Technical improvements such as reinforced cement pipes, stormwater detention basins, and advanced modeling methods improved the effectiveness and usefulness of drainage solutions, permitting engineers to deal with complex hydrological challenges.

Municipalities, energy companies, and private contractors collaborate to design, develop, perform, and maintain drainage infrastructure, hiring interdisciplinary approaches that include executive, environmental science, and downtown preparing principles. Drainage programs on average consist of a network of pipes, culverts, stations, and storage features built to express, store, and address stormwater and sewage. Contemporary drainage infrastructure also incorporates natural infrastructure aspects such as for instance permeable streets, rain gardens, and made wetlands, that assist attenuate runoff, reduce pollution, and increase environment services.

Crucial aspects of drainage service include stormwater management, sewerage techniques, ton get a handle on, and water quality protection. Stormwater administration requires the selection, conveyance, and therapy of rainwater runoff from impervious areas such as roads, rooftops, and parking lots. Conventional stormwater infrastructure includes surprise drains, get basins, and detention lakes, which catch and communicate runoff to organic water figures or treatment facilities. In recent years, there has been rising interest in green stormwater infrastructure approaches, which simulate normal hydrological techniques to handle runoff more sustainably.

Sewerage techniques enjoy a vital position in transporting wastewater from homes, firms, and industries to therapy flowers for filter and disposal. Mixed sewer systems, common in older towns, express both sanitary sewage and stormwater in the exact same pipes, posing problems during major rainfall events when volume may be exceeded, ultimately causing overflows and water pollution. In comparison, split up sewer techniques hold stormwater and sewage split, lowering the danger of contamination and increasing treatment efficiency. Advances in sewer technology, such as for instance trenchless pipe restoration and distant monitoring systems, have increased the consistency and longevity of sewerage infrastructure.
